Achieving Work-Life Balance in a Remote Workspace
Working from home offers both tremendous flexibility to develop a healthier work-life balance. Nevertheless, it demands conscious effort from leading to blurring the lines between your professional and personal life.
It's crucial to create distinct boundaries between work hours and personal time. This could include designating a specific workspace, setting aside dedicated work periods, and notifying your colleagues and family about your availability.
Furthermore, prioritize time off throughout the day to rest and prevent burnout. Dedicate time to things you enjoy outside of work to de-stress and.
Remember, maintaining a healthy work-life balance is an ongoing process. Allow time for adjustments and continuously evaluate your strategies to ensure they suit your requirements.
